a) The null hypothesis states that
The production line operation fills cartons with laundry detergent to a mean weight of 32 ounces.
H0 : µ = 32
The alternative hypothesis states that
The production line operation overfills or under fills cartons with the laundry detergent to a mean weight of above or below 32 ounces.
Ha : µ ≠ 32
b) when the calculations are done and the p value is determined, then it would be compared with the level of significance
When the significance level is lesser than the p value, we do not reject H0 because there is no sufficient evidence to conclude that the production line operation overfills or under fills cartons.
c) When the significance level is greater than the p value, we would reject H0 because there is sufficient evidence to conclude that the production line operation overfills or under fills cartons.
